What Is Social Media Support?

Social media support simply means using platforms like Facebook or X to help customers when they have questions or problems. Instead of calling or emailing, people now prefer sending a message or posting a comment on social media. It’s faster and feels more personal.

Let’s say someone ordered a product online, but it hasn’t arrived. Instead of waiting on hold to speak to someone, they can just send a quick message on social media. A good support team will reply quickly and solve the issue. This is what social media support is all about—helping customers where they already are.

Why Is Social Media Support Important?

  1. It’s Fast
    In today’s busy life, people don’t want to wait for days to get help. Social media support allows businesses to respond within minutes or hours. This makes customers happy and builds trust.

  2. It’s Public
    When businesses solve problems openly on social media, others can see it too. It shows that the business cares and is active in helping. This can build a strong reputation and attract more customers.

  3. It Feels Personal
    When someone gets a reply on their comment or a direct message from a brand, it feels like the brand is talking directly to them. Social media support helps make the customer experience feel human and friendly.

How Does Social Media Support Work?

Most businesses have a team that checks their social media accounts regularly. They watch for any messages, mentions, or comments that need attention. These could be questions like “What are your store hours?” or more serious issues like “I received the wrong item.”

The team replies with helpful information, apologizes if needed, and finds a solution. Sometimes, they take the conversation to private messages if the issue involves personal details. Social media support is not just about replying—it’s about solving problems with care and speed.

The Benefits of Social Media Support for Businesses

  • Better Customer Satisfaction
    When people get fast and helpful replies, they are more likely to be happy and come back in the future.

  • Stronger Brand Image
    By being active and helpful on social media, businesses can build a positive image. Others will see that the company listens and cares.

  • Lower Support Costs
    Social media support can be cheaper than phone or email support. One person can handle many messages at once, making the process more efficient.

  • More Feedback
    Social media gives businesses a chance to listen to what people are saying. They can learn what’s working and what needs improvement.

Tips for Effective Social Media Support

  1. Respond Quickly
    People expect fast replies. The quicker the response, the better the experience.

  2. Stay Polite and Friendly
    Even if a customer is upset, a calm and kind reply can turn the situation around.

  3. Be Clear and Helpful
    Avoid using confusing words. The goal is to solve the issue, not make it worse.

  4. Know When to Take It Private
    If a problem needs personal information, it’s best to move the conversation to direct messages.

  5. Use Tools to Help
    There are many tools that help manage social media support, like showing all messages in one place or setting up auto-replies when the team is offline.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Ignoring Messages
    Every message matters. Ignoring even one can damage the business’s image.

  • Copy-Paste Replies
    People can tell when replies are not personal. Try to make each message feel real and thoughtful.

  • Getting Defensive
    Sometimes customers will complain in public. Instead of arguing, it’s better to stay calm and offer help.
